Natural disasters take many different forms and can happen without warning. Earthquakes, floods, volcanoes, droughts, typhoons, and hurricanes are all natural disasters.
The earthquake of 26 December 2004 resulted in one of the worst natural disasters in living memory. It was a massive underwater quake that occurred in the Indian Ocean. This caused a huge tsunami to cross the Indian Ocean. It destroyed coastlines and communities and brought death and destruction to many people. The survivors needed fresh water, food and shelter as well as medical help. People from all over the world gave money.
The surface of the Earth has not always looked as it does today; it is moving continuously (although very slowly) and has done so for billions of years. This is one cause of earthquakes, when one section of the Earth crashes with another. Scientists can predict where this might happen and the area between plates is called a fault line. However, earthquakes do not always happen on fault lines, which is why they are so dangerous and unpredictable.
All the disasters are very dangerous and continue to kill thousands of people each year, but they are nowhere near the most dangerous disaster to ever happen on earth. One type of event in the earth’s history has regularly killed millions of beings: asteroid (小行星) impacts (撞击). About once every million years the Earth is hit by a piece of rock and ice from space large enough to cause massive destruction (including earthquakes, volcanoes and ice ages) and sometimes to kill entire species. Sixty-five million years ago more than half the earth’s species were killed by such a disaster, including all the dinosaurs. Disasters on the Earth may seem dangerous, but the biggest threat to humans is likely to come from space.

36. Nobody knows the reason_________she didn't attend the meeting. (用适当的词填空)
【答案】why
【解析】
【详解】考查定语从句。句意:没有人知道她为什么没有参加会议。设空后为定语从句,修饰先行词reason,关系词在从句中作原因状语,用关系副词why引导该从句。故填why。
37. If a shop has chairs ________ women can park their men, women will spend more time in the shop. (用适当的词填空)
【答案】where##on which
【解析】
【详解】考查定语从句。句意:如果商店有椅子,可供女人们安顿他们的丈夫,女人们在商店就会花更多时间。分析句子可知,空格处引导定语从句,先行词为chairs,关系副词where引导从句,相当于on which,在从句中作地点状语,把先行词还原到定语从句中为:women can park their men on chairs (there)。故填where/on which。
38. The top priority of education is to cultivate the sense of ______(responsible) among the students. (所给词的适当形式填空)
【答案】responsibility
【解析】
【详解】考查名词。句意:教育的首要任务是培养学生的责任感。设空处为名词作介词of 的宾语,为抽象名词,不可数,根据句意,故填responsibility。
39. This science based theme park in France uses the most _________(advance) technology. (用所给词的适当形式填空)
【答案】advanced
【解析】
【详解】考查形容词。句意:法国的这个以科学为基础的主题公园采用了最先进的技术。分析句子可知,空处作修饰technology的定语,空前有the most,结合This science based theme park可知,advance的形容词形式advanced符合题意,意为“先进的”,和the most构成最高级,表示最先进的。故填advanced。
40. Both of the ways are __________(effect) and which one to choose is really a matter of personal preference. (所给词的适当形式填空)
【答案】effective
【解析】
【详解】考查形容词。句意:两种方法都是有效的,选择哪一种真的是个人喜好的问题。空格处用形容词作表语,effect的形容词是effective,意为“有效的”,故填effective。
41. You’d better not walk along the narrow path, or you may do an ________(injure) to yourself. (用所给词的适当形式填空)
【答案】injury
【解析】
【详解】考查名词作宾语。句意:你最好不要沿着窄路走,否则你可能会伤到自己。动词do后应使用名词作宾语,前有an修饰,故填injury。
42. The amount of money they have is so ________(limit) that they can't afford to buy a new car. (用所给词的适当形式填空)
【答案】limited
【解析】
【详解】考查形容词。句意:他们钱有限,买不起一辆新车。分析句子结构可知,空处需使用形容词limited(有限的)在句中作表语。故填limited。
43. I’d appreciate it if you could help me fill in the ________ (apply) form for a new passport.(用所给词的适当形式填空)
【答案】application
【解析】
【详解】考查名词。句意:如果你能帮我填写新护照的申请表,我将不胜感激。结合句意表达“申请表”用application form,名词application作form的定语,抽象概念,不可数。故填application。
44. The speaker raised his voice to make himself__________(hear). (所给词的适当形式填空)
【答案】heard
【解析】
【详解】考查过去分词。句意:这位演讲者为了使自己被听见而提高了嗓音。分析句子结构,这里是“make+宾语+宾补”结构,宾语himself和动词hear之间是动宾关系,所以应用过去分词作宾补。故填heard。
45. I usually have fast food ________(deliver) to my office when I am busy. (所给词的适当形式填空)
【答案】delivered
【解析】
【详解】考查过去分词。句意:当我忙的时候,我通常叫快餐送到我的办公室。分析句子可知,此处为动词短语have sth done“使某事被做”,满足句意要求, fast food与deliver之间为被动关系,所以此处为过去分词形式作宾补成分。故填delivered。
